问题标签 [jquery-ui-plugins]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
2185 浏览

jquery - 销毁 jquery ui 插件实例

我有一个标签插件。

该插件正在通过 ajax 生成的表单元素上使用。

就像是

现在,当表单被提交(通过 ajax)时,灯箱被移除,因此表单也是如此。

但,

如果我单击按钮创建一个新表单,则插件处于其先前状态,即使 #groups 现在是一个全新的 dom 元素。

为什么会这样,我该如何解决?

(我的意思是处于同一状态)

我有一个变量是插件

_vars : {tags: []}

这会随着标签的添加而填充。当在新的#groups 上再次调用插件时,tags 变量包含来自前一个实例的所有标签。

我怎样才能解决这个问题?


代码

0 投票
1 回答
2186 浏览

javascript - 使用 jqueryui 的自动完成时的附加参数

我希望向 jquery UI 自动完成请求添加一个附加参数,而不必在 ajax 调用中嵌套 json 返回。我会设想类似以下的工作,但是 data: 选项不会像普通的 jquery ajax 请求一样传递给 ajax 请求。

tl;博士我需要帮助传递&action=getUserName给 ajax 以进行自动完成,最好不要将其嵌套在 ajax 回调中。

0 投票
1 回答
2665 浏览

asp.net-mvc-3 - ASP.Net MVC 3 中的 jQuery 模式登录

我试图让这个http://blog.stevehorn.cc/2009/06/rendering-modal-dialog-with-aspnet-mvc.html与 MVC 3 一起工作。

我是 ASP.Net MVC 的新手,最近开始了一个 MVC 3 项目。当用户单击我的 _Layout.cshtml 文件中的登录超链接时,我想显示一个模式登录表单:

我在以下位置创建了一个登录视图 Areas/Auth/Views/Auth/Login.cshtml

我已将以下脚本添加到我的 _Layout.cshtml 文件中:

并向我的 AuthController 添加了 PartialViewResult:

但是,单击登录链接时没有任何反应。任何关于这样做的好的 MVC 3 教程的建议或链接,将不胜感激。

谢谢!

0 投票
2 回答
6194 浏览

jquery - 带有 jQ​​uery UI 1.8.9 对话框和 jQuery 1.5 的 bgiframe

所以我正在使用 jQuery UI 的对话框。但正如我所读的,IE6 中有一个常见的错误(不幸的是,我必须确保它适用)下拉列表不关注 z-index 队列。我还读到有一个方便的插件叫做 bgiframe 来解决我的覆盖问题。我发现人们说使用它的两种不同方式,但都不起作用。我可能只是在做一些非常愚蠢的事情,但我需要让它发挥作用。

包括 jQuery.bgiframe.js 版本 2.1.1 以下是我尝试在不工作的情况下使用它的两种方法:(我在我正在处理的页面中包含了所有 jQuery-UI、jQuery 和 bgiframe)

  1. 实际插件的文档说这样做:

    这会导致一个 jQuery 异常,说 Object 是预期的。

  2. 我从以下页面看到的第二种方式:http: //docs.jquery.com/UI/Dialog/dialog基本上你只是bgiframe: true在初始化对话框时设置:

    /li>

这不会出错,但是当我测试它时,问题仍然存在于 IE6 中。

我错过了什么吗?我应该以哪种方式使用 bgiframe?任何方向将不胜感激。谢谢您的帮助!

0 投票
2 回答
638 浏览

list - MVC3:IE8 因在列表中使用 JqueryUI 而崩溃

我正在使用 VS2010+MVC3(Razor)+IE8+JQueryUI 堆栈,我试图使用 jqueryui .buttons() 函数创建按钮列表。但是,由于某些未知原因,当按下按钮时,它会始终使 Dev-Webserver+IE8 崩溃。下面的代码对于演示该错误是必要且足够的。只需将其剪切并粘贴到您的 Home/Index.chtml 文件中并运行。

这适用于 Chrome,如果将其放入纯 HTML 文件并在 VS2010 之外运行,也不会发生错误,因此这可能是 MVC/ASP 特有的。删除周围的 div 将阻止它崩溃。值得注意的是,这只在按钮是 div 组中的最后一个按钮时才会崩溃。作为 hack,我在输入元素之后添加了一个空 div,这阻止了它崩溃。这是一个非常特殊的错误,因此我将其发布在这里,以防有人遇到类似的麻烦。

干杯抢

0 投票
2 回答
2446 浏览

jquery-ui - jQuery UI 手风琴和分页

有没有人有幸获得任何类型的分页插件来与 jQuery UI Accordion 一起使用?当我使用 SimplePager 时,一切都会中断。

0 投票
1 回答
1549 浏览

jquery-ui - jQuery UI Autocomplete 如何在现有设置中实现必须匹配?

我有以下代码,并且很好奇如何强制输入与自动完成的内容相匹配:

0 投票
2 回答
11621 浏览

jquery-ui - jQuery UI 1.8.17 和选择菜单

这个问题的答案可能会给我一个“doh!” 时刻,但是我在哪里可以找到一个可以与后期(ish)jquery ui版本一起使用的工作选择菜单插件?

我从所有这些地方都试过了,但似乎都没有奏效:

http://www.filamentgroup.com/lab/jquery_ui_selectmenu_an_aria_accessible_plugin_for_styling_a_html_select/

https://github.com/fnagel/jquery-ui

http://view.jqueryui.com/selectmenu/demos/selectmenu/default.html

http://jqueryui.com/download

如果您认为其中任何一个应该起作用,请指出我正确的方向,以便我可以调查为什么它对我不起作用。

0 投票
1 回答
1598 浏览

jquery-ui - jQuery-ui:如何从私有函数内部访问选项

我正在学习使用小部件工厂模式编写 jquery-ui 插件。为了更简洁的组织,我在传递给 $.widget. 我想访问这些助手中的选项对象。例如在下面的样板中,我如何访问里面的选项对象_helper()

谢谢你。

0 投票
1 回答
647 浏览

jquery - 分页不一致/工作

在使用 JavaScript 对数据库进行 Ajax 调用后,我在客户端有 8000 行 JSON 格式的数据,我需要将这些数据填充到 HTML 表中以进行显示。

我正在尝试运行下面的代码,但遇到以下问题:由于我有大量数据,当我在 Web 界面上查询时,会进行几次 Ajax 调用以从数据库中提取数据并在 HTML 页面上显示相同的数据。

我面临以下问题:

  1. 只有当结果很大时我才会看到分页
  2. 出现分页时,所有数据首先加载到页面上,而不是每页 10 或 25 个,因此我的 jQuery 脚本变得无响应。但是在我切换分页大小过滤器 10、25、50 或 100 后,会出现正确数量的结果。

我正在尝试的代码如下。

HTML:

JAVASCRIPT:

仅供参考,我正在销毁数据表实例,因为我收到“无法重新实例化 DataTable”错误,这是推荐的解决方案。

每次用户单击表单上的提交按钮时,都会调用上面的 Ajax Post,并使用不同的sidmpid值。

包含的 JS 文件: